10.7.3 is working fine for me on a mid-2011 iMac.
Download the 10.7.3 combo update from http://support.apple.com/kb/DL1484 . After downloading, use Disk Utility (on your hard drive in applications/utilities) to repair permissions, then apply the update, then when done and rebooted, repair permissions again.
Sometimes, Software Update doesn't quite get the update right and odd things can happen. Applying the combo update can usually fix those issues.
Also, you can do a safe boot by rebooting and holding the shift key down. This will take longer than a normal boot. See if the system crashes that way. If not, look at your login items and at your system preferences pane to see what is loading with the system. You may have a compatibility issue with non-Apple software you've added.
If those actions don't help, contact Apple support or take it back to the store for help. It's a new system and you shouldn't have that type of issue. -

That's correct. Avoid FW offloading on a PC; in fact, while it used to be the way to interface a P2 camera with a Mac, it's all USB there now, as well. Stick with USB, and you'll be fine. (I know this wasn't the gist of your thread, but I thought I'd shine a little light on that.)
One is an error code that thanks to this thread I know is related to the audio gain. My problem is that I have done everything I can think of and still no luck. It's been crashing with such regularity that my reporters are saving every few minutes, and I have the auto save set to 5 minutes. Today I had to reinstall this bay because it was crashing every time audio gain was adjusted.
This is known/acknowledged/as-yet-unsquashed bug, assuming that you're remapping your MXF audio channels from the two mono channels that are originally produced by the camera to a single stereo channel. You may be doing this manually, in the bin, or you might have a preference set to do this automatically on import (Edit > Preferences > Audio > Source Channel Mapping; if it's set to Stereo, try setting it to Use File). This bug only seems to rear its head when the mono channels of an MXF clip are remapped to stereo; if they remain as mono, you can use the Audio Gain command successfully.
If, however, your audio channels aren't stereo, post back; there might be something else going on.

USB Device: Apple Pro Keyboard, Mitsumi Electric, Up to 12 Mb/sec, 250 mAHi Peter. I have the same problem with my Mac and BlackBerry 8703e. But I have found the problem only occurs if the BB is connected to my iMac via the USB cable when I boot up the Mac. To resovle this I leave the BB USB cable unconnected from the Mac until I need to sync using PocketMac. The rest of the time, my BB is plugged into its power adapter cable in order to stay charged. Still a weird problem though!
